<p>During our <a href="http://phonedifferent.com/2008/03/phone_different_podcast_13.html">last regularly scheduled podcast</a>, we received an dispatch from Hong Kong written by one Janric.  We already knew that there were somewhere in the neighborhood of <a href="http://phonedifferent.com/2008/02/1_in_10_iphones_unlocked_used.html">400,000 unlocked iPhones in China alone</a>, and Janric confirmed that you can&#8217;t walk down a Hong Kong alley without tripping over somebody that has one:</p>

<blockquote>
  <p><em>I just want to comment out on the news about the 400K iPhones that are loose in china. I&#8217;m based in Hong Kong and it&#8217;s
  no secret that you can buy the iphone here almost anywhere. The iPhone is such a hit here that I can almost see 1 iPhone per day (excluding mine ofcourse). In my office alone, there are about 5 unlocked iPhones in use.</em></p>
</blockquote>

<p>Don&#8217;t believe it?  Check out these photos that Janric snapped in an area of <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Causeway_Bay">Causeway Bay</a> &#8211; just a random two block stroll:</p>

<p>We&#8217;ve heard firsthand reports that it&#8217;s pretty much the same situation on the opposite side of the planet (Sweden) as well.  So basically it&#8217;s as easy to get an unlocked iPhone in areas Apple hasn&#8217;t made official yet as it is to get a locked-up one in the official zones.  If Apple wants to get their preferred revenue sharing going in these places, they need to step up the pace of worldwide releases.</p>
